The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on, commonly known as the Ceylon Copperleaf, is a stunning tropical plant renowned for its vibrant foliage. Native to the tropical regions of the Pacific Islands, this perennial shrub showcases a kaleidoscope of colors, including deep greens, reds, and yellows, making it a favorite among gardeners and landscapers alike. Its unique leaf shape and striking patterns add a touch of exotic beauty to any garden or indoor space.
What makes the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on special is its ability to thrive in various environments, from tropical gardens to indoor settings. This plant not only enhances aesthetic appeal but also contributes to air purification, making it a valuable addition to your home. Its resilience and adaptability make it a perfect choice for both novice and experienced gardeners.
One of the standout features of the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on is its colorful foliage, which can change hues with the seasons, providing year-round interest. Additionally, it attracts pollinators like butterflies and bees, promoting biodiversity in your garden. With proper care, this plant can grow up to 3 feet tall, creating a lush, tropical atmosphere.
If you think caring for Acalypha wilkesiana is like babysitting a cactus, think again! This tropical beauty thrives on attention and a bit of pampering. Keep her in bright, indirect sunlight, and she’ll reward you with vibrant foliage that could make a rainbow jealous. Water her when the top inch of soil feels dry, but don’t drown her—she’s not a fan of soggy feet. Fertilize every month during the growing season, and she’ll strut her stuff like a diva at a fashion show. Remember, a happy Acalypha is a colorful Acalypha!
Want to multiply your Acalypha wilkesiana like rabbits? Propagation is the way to go! Snip a healthy stem with a few leaves, pop it in water or moist soil, and watch the magic happen. In a few weeks, you’ll have new plants ready to take over your garden or impress your friends. Just remember, patience is key—good things come to those who wait, and soon you’ll be the proud parent of a mini Acalypha army!
Ah, the dreaded pests! Acalypha wilkesiana can attract some uninvited guests like aphids and spider mites. But fear not! A little neem oil or insecticidal soap can send those pesky critters packing. Keep an eye out for any signs of trouble, and act fast—after all, you wouldn’t let a party crasher ruin your garden soirée, would you? With a little vigilance, your Acalypha will remain the belle of the botanical ball.
Acalypha wilkesiana is a sun-loving diva, but she prefers her rays filtered. Direct sunlight can scorch her leaves, turning her vibrant colors into a sad shade of brown. Instead, give her a cozy spot with bright, indirect light, and she’ll flourish like a star on the red carpet. If you notice her stretching towards the light, it’s time to adjust her position—she’s not shy about asking for a better view!
When it comes to soil, Acalypha wilkesiana is a bit of a snob. She craves well-draining, rich soil that’s as luxurious as a five-star hotel. A mix of potting soil, peat, and perlite will keep her roots happy and healthy. Avoid heavy clay or compacted soil—she’s not a fan of being suffocated. With the right soil, your Acalypha will thrive and reward you with foliage that’s the envy of the neighborhood.
Bringing Acalypha wilkesiana indoors? You’re in for a treat! This plant can brighten up any room with its stunning leaves. Just make sure to place her near a window with filtered light, and keep the humidity levels up—she loves a good steam bath! Water her when the soil dries out, and don’t forget to dust her leaves occasionally. A clean plant is a happy plant, and she’ll show off her colors like a proud peacock.
Ready to take your Acalypha wilkesiana outside? She’ll thrive in warm, tropical climates, so make sure to plant her in a spot that gets plenty of filtered sunlight. Choose a well-draining soil mix, and give her enough space to spread her vibrant leaves. Just be cautious of chilly nights—she’s not a fan of frost! With the right conditions, your outdoor Acalypha will become the talk of the garden party.
Pruning Acalypha wilkesiana is like giving her a stylish haircut—she’ll appreciate the attention! Regular trimming helps maintain her shape and encourages bushier growth. Snip away any dead or yellowing leaves, and don’t be afraid to cut back leggy stems. Just remember, less is more—over-pruning can leave her feeling a bit exposed. With a little snip here and there, you’ll have a well-groomed plant that’s ready for its close-up.
Feeding your Acalypha wilkesiana is like treating her to a gourmet meal. Use a balanced liquid fertilizer every month during the growing season, and she’ll reward you with lush, vibrant foliage. Just be careful not to overdo it—too much fertilizer can lead to a case of the “burnt leaf blues.” A well-fed Acalypha is a happy Acalypha, and she’ll show off her colors like a star at a gala.
Acalypha wilkesiana is a tropical plant that loves warm weather, so keep her cozy! Ideal temperatures range from 60°F to 85°F. She’s not a fan of cold drafts or sudden temperature changes, so avoid placing her near air conditioning vents or drafty windows. If you keep her warm and toasty, she’ll reward you with vibrant leaves that scream “tropical paradise!”

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on, also known as Ceylon copperleaf, is a tropical plant with vibrant, multicolored leaves. It’s like nature’s confetti, adding a splash of color to your garden or home. This beauty thrives in warm climates and is perfect for those who want to impress their neighbors with a touch of exotic flair.
Caring for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on is like nurturing a diva. It loves bright, indirect sunlight and moist, well-draining soil. Water it regularly, but don’t drown it—this plant prefers a sip over a swim. Fertilize every few weeks during the growing season to keep it looking fabulous and vibrant.
Absolutely!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on can be a fabulous indoor companion. Just ensure it gets enough bright, indirect light, and it will thrive like a star in the spotlight. Keep the humidity high, and it’ll reward you with its stunning foliage, making your living space feel like a tropical paradise.
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on loves warm, humid environments—think tropical vacation vibes! It prefers temperatures between 60°F to 85°F and well-draining soil. Keep it in bright, indirect light, and watch it flourish. Just remember, it’s not a fan of frost; it’s more of a sunbather than a snow angel.
Yes,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on is mildly toxic to pets. If your furry friend decides to munch on its leaves, they might experience some tummy troubles. It’s best to keep this plant out of reach of curious paws and noses. After all, we wouldn’t want your pet to have a botanical buffet!
Watering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on is like a balancing act. Aim for once a week, allowing the top inch of soil to dry out between waterings. In hotter months, it might crave a little more moisture. Just remember, soggy roots are a no-go; this diva prefers to sip, not swim!
Yes, you can propagate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on! Snip a healthy stem cutting, let it dry for a few hours, and then plant it in moist soil. Keep it warm and humid, and soon you’ll have a new plant to show off. It’s like cloning your favorite celebrity—more of that fabulous foliage!
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on can attract pests like aphids and spider mites. Keep an eye out for these uninvited guests, as they can sap your plant’s energy. A gentle spray of insecticidal soap or neem oil can send them packing. After all, your plant deserves a pest-free life, not a bug buffet!
Pruning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on is like giving it a stylish haircut. Trim back any leggy growth or yellowing leaves to encourage bushiness and vibrant new growth. Use clean, sharp scissors, and don’t be afraid to get creative. Your plant will thank you for the fresh look and a chance to shine!
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on loves a balanced, water-soluble fertilizer. Look for one with equal parts n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ium. Feed it every 4-6 weeks during the growing season, and it’ll reward you with lush, colorful foliage. Think of it as a spa day for your plant—everyone loves a little pampering!
Acalypha wilkesiana Ceylon is not a fan of winter chills. If you live in a cooler climate, bring it indoors before the frost hits. Keep it in a warm, bright spot, and it’ll survive the winter months. Just remember, it’s a tropical plant at heart, dreaming of sunny days and warm breezes!
